Corynoline
0 ImagesCorynoline is an orally active acetylcholinesterase (AChE) inhibitor with an IC50 of 30.6 μM. Corynoline exhibits multiple activities including anti-inflammatory, antinociceptive, antitumor and analgesic effects. Corydaline
0 ImagesCorydaline ((+)-Corydaline), an isoquinoline alkaloid isolated from Corydalis yanhusuo, is an AChE inhibitor with an IC50 of 226 μM. Corydaline is a μ-opioid receptor (Ki of 1.23 μM) agonist and inhibits enterovirus 71 (EV71) replication (IC50 of 25.23 μM). Ethopropazine hydrochloride
0 ImagesEthopropazine (Isothazine) hydrochloride is a potent and selective BChE inhibitor, a poor AChE inhibitor and a non-selective mAChR and NMDA antagonist. Ethopropazine hydrochloride has anticholinergic, antihistamine, antiadrenergic actions and properties. Ethopropazine hydrochloride alleviates thermal hyperalgesia in a dose dependent manner. Physostigmine salicylate
0 ImagesPhysostigmine salicylate (Eserine salicylate) is a reversible acetylcholinesterase (AChE) inhibitor. Physostigmine salicylate crosses the blood-brain barrier and stimulates central cholinergic neurotransmission. Physostigmine salicylate can reverse memory deficits in transgenic mice with Alzheimer's disease. Physostigmine salicylate is also an antidote for anticholinergic poisoning. -

Galanthamine hydrobromide
0 ImagesGalanthamine hydrobromide (Galantamine hydrobromide) is a selective, reversible, competitive, alkaloid AChE inhibitor, with an IC50 of 0.35 µM. Galanthamine hydrobromide is a potent allosteric potentiating ligand (APL) of human α3β4, α4β2, α6β4 nicotinic receptors ( nAChRs). Minaprine dihydrochloride
0 ImagesMinaprine dihydrochloride is a brain-penetrant monoamine oxidase inhibitor. Minaprine dihydrochloride also weakly inhibits acetylcholinesterase (AChE) activity. Minaprine dihydrochloride reduces intraneuronal dopamine metabolism, lowers striatal homovanillic acid and dihydroxyphenylacetic acid levels, and raises striatal 3-methoxytyramine and 5-hydroxytryptamine levels. Pralidoxime chloride
0 ImagesPralidoxime chloride is a potent reactivator of acetylcholinesterase (AChE). Pralidoxime chloride reactivates nerve agent-inhibited AChE via direct nucleophilic attack by the oxime moiety on the phosphorus center of the bound nerve agent. Pralidoxime chloride is an antidote for organophosphate poisoning. -
